AI is unleashing a massive job-cutting tsunami across corporate America, with Amazon axing 14,000-30,000 roles to streamline via automation, while Meta, Salesforce, and others ditch entry-level gigs, widening a stark tech divide and threatening millions of routine jobs from retail to white-collar. Experts like Priestley, Ford's Farley, and Fed's Powell warn this hyper-fast disruption—cramming decades of change into years—echoes past revolutions but hits harder, amid a stingy job market, government shutdown chaos delaying data, Fed rate cuts to tame inflation, and buoyant AI-fueled markets (S&P up 17%) facing pullback risks.
